Description

### Describe the bug

When I'm receiving instructions for using GitHub from its copilot, I must close the chat window in order to try the instructions. Since copilot almost always fails to give correct instructions about GitHub, I must resume the conversation by clicking the Copilot button. But then Copilot forgets all previous conversations and starts fresh. I can't find the Copilot version.

### Affected version

_No response_

### Steps to reproduce the behavior

1. Open a repository with code files.
2. Open Copilot. Ask for instructions to upload a file to your repository.
3. Close copilot dialog using the X icon.
4. Click the Code or '+' icon as a simulated GitHub operation.
5. Return to copilot using the ugly face icon.
6. Ask copilot if it remembers your conversation about instructions.
7. Sometimes it does remember and apologizes for forgetting. Other times it can't remember any previous conversation.

### Expected behavior

I expect it to act like standalone Claude and retain the current conversation context across being completely closed and opened again.

### Additional context

Dell Latitude, Windows 11 Pro, Edge browser, GitHub repo 'https://github.com/David263/itma-loop-memorizer'.

Note: part of the problem maybe Copilot's failure to adapt its output to the user's experience level. I am a beginner with GitHub.
